Ergonomic Workspace Setup

Creating an ergonomic workspace is essential not only for comfort but also for maintaining your overall health and wellness, especially when it comes to preventing tension headaches and supporting your spine.

Here are some simple adjustments you can make to your workspace that promote natural healing and optimal health, while also positioning chiropractic care as a vital component in your wellness journey.

Start with your chair: Make sure it allows your feet to rest flat on the floor, providing a stable base. Your knees should be at or slightly below hip level. This helps maintain proper spinal alignment—a key focus in chiropractic care.

Adjust your desk height so that your elbows are at a 90-degree angle when typing; this reduces strain on your neck and back.

Your monitor is crucial too! Position it at eye level and about an arm’s length away. This minimizes neck strain and promotes a natural head position, which is essential for spinal health.

A chair that offers lower back support will encourage good posture, which is another key principle in chiropractic care.

Don’t forget about your keyboard and mouse! Keep them within easy reach to avoid overextending your arms, which can lead to discomfort and tension.

These straightforward adjustments can significantly impact how you feel throughout the day.

Frequency and Duration Guidelines

To effectively relieve tension headaches, establishing a consistent exercise routine is key.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ity each week, which can be easily broken down to about 30 minutes a day, five days a week. This not only helps alleviate headaches but also promotes overall well-being, all while supporting your spinal health.

In addition to aerobic activities, incorporating strength training exercises twice a week can enhance muscle support and flexibility. This is crucial for maintaining proper posture and reducing strain on your spine, which can contribute to tension headaches.

It’s important to listen to your body—if you start to feel fatigued or uncomfortable, don’t hesitate to adjust your routine. Remember, short and frequent workouts can often be more beneficial than sporadic, longer sessions.

Also, try to integrate stretching or yoga a few times a week; these practices promote relaxation and help reduce muscle tension, further supporting your spinal health.

Trying Cold or Warm Compresses

Alongside the benefits of chiropractic care, incorporating cold or warm compresses into your routine can be an effective way to alleviate tension headaches and promote overall wellness.

Applying a cold or warm compress to your forehead or neck can help reduce pain and encourage relaxation. Here are some advantages of using compresses:

  • Cold compresses can help numb the area, which may reduce inflammation and ease tension by constricting blood vessels.
  • Warm compresses can provide soothing relief by relaxing tense muscles and improving blood circulation.
  • Alternating between cold and warm compresses can enhance relief and provide comfort.
  • Both methods are simple to use and can easily be done at home, making them a great companion to your chiropractic care.

To create a cold compress, wrap ice in a cloth or use a chilled gel pack. For a warm compress, soak a towel in warm water and apply it to the affected area.

It’s important to listen to your body and experiment with each type to see which one brings you the most relief. While using compresses, take a moment to relax and unwind—your headache relief might be just a compress away!
